Thanks for the responses guys.

As John said, my car is primarily a street/autocross car. I don't have the resources to buy a trailer, etc...so I can attend more open track days. But I hope to make 5 or so next year, including the Glen.

I wasn't too worried about 210, but it was pushing above that, and that's when I thought it wise to pull into the pits. Luckily, the checkered flag was just starting to waive as I pulled in, so I really didn't miss too much. Do you guys push out the overflow often?

My car will probably never see temps below freezing, so maybe I should change to either straight water, or just a little anti-freeze.

John, you don't think my oil took a beating with the climbing temps. Since I don't have the temp gauge, I have no way of knowing how hot it was.

I will be very interested to talk to Terry about how he does with the 3 link. I was very, very impressed with it in my initial drives. The car felt vastly different than in July. The rear felt well planted on Saturday, where in July, when pushed, the rear "wagged" a little going into corners.
